Burhia Sarai Population - Giridih, Jharkhand
Burhia Sarai is a medium size village located in Bengabad Block of Giridih district, Jharkhand with total 60 families residing. The Burhia Sarai village has population of 313 of which 148 are males while 165 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Burhia Sarai village population of children with age 0-6 is 77 which makes up 24.60 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Burhia Sarai village is 1115 which is higher than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Burhia Sarai as per census is 750, lower than Jharkhand average of 948.
Burhia Sarai village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Burhia Sarai village was 47.46 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Burhia Sarai Male literacy stands at 61.54 % while female literacy rate was 36.36 %.

Burhia Sarai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 60 | - | - |
Population | 313 | 148 | 165 |
Child (0-6) | 77 | 44 | 33 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 278 | 130 | 148 |
Literacy | 47.46 % | 61.54 % | 36.36 % |
Total Workers | 179 | 84 | 95 |
Main Worker | 40 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 139 | 49 | 90 |
